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Evelin Rios conducted an announced Prelicensing  visit to complete Component III orientation. This is a new application for and Adult Residential Facility (ARF) Level 4i. LPA met with the applicant Audrey Hughes. Fire clearance inspection was approved on 02/21/24 with the approved capacity for four (4) ambulatory clients.

A tour of the physical plant inside and out was conducted with Audrey Hughes and Jer'Marcus Dumas at approximately 10:00 a.m.

Common Areas: These included the den, dining area and living area. The common areas were checked for cleanliness and furniture was checked for functionality. All areas were clean, sanitary and furniture was in good repair. In the den, LPA observed board games and sufficient space for activities. Dining table and couches sit the capacity of the facility. The facility was kept at a comfortable temperature.

Bedrooms:  LPA inspected four (4) client bedrooms. LPA observed bedrooms to be properly furnished and had adequate lighting. The bedrooms had appropriate and adequate bedding and linens such as sheets, pillowcases, mattress covers, and blankets. Bedroom also stored sufficient amounts of personal hygiene supplies.

Bathrooms:  LPA observed all two and half bathrooms to be clean, properly supplied with toilet paper, hand soup, paper towels and trash bins with lids. LPA observed bathrooms had functional fixtures.

Smoke detectors and Carbon Monoxide detectors were tested and observed to be functioning properly. Two (2) Fire extinguishers were fully charged and were purchased on 02/19/24.  (continued to LIC 809-C)

There is a complete first aid kit with up to date manual in a linen closet and Emergency disaster kits appeared to be sufficient for the current capacity.

Kitchen:  The kitchen appliances and fixtures appeared functional. LPA observed refrigerator and freezer at proper temperatures. There was a sufficient amount of non-perishable foods properly stored in the kitchen cabinets. The facility telephone is located on the kitchen counter and was functioning properly. Knives and sharps are locked in a lock box in the laundry room cabinet inaccessible to clients.

Medications/Facility Files: LPA observed the office that will be maintained locked used for medication storage. Medication will be locked in individual lock boxes. Client and staff records will be maintained locked in the office.

Laundry/Garage: LPA observed the laundry room to be accessible to clients and detergent and cleaning supplies will be maintained locked in cabinets in the laundry room. The garage is accessible through the laundry room and the doors to the garage are maintained locked.

Surrounding Grounds (Outdoors): There is a gazebo and an umbrella for shade with proper furniture for outdoor use in the backyard.  There are no bodies of water on the premises. Entry/exits were free of obstruction. The outdoor area was clean and free of hazards.

Component III was conducted on site with Audrey Hughes & Jer'Marcus Dumas.

Pursuant to Title 22, Division 6, facility observed to be compliant with regulation.  Pre-Licensing is complete and this facility has no deficiencies observed.  A copy of this report will be forwarded to the application specialist.
